Midnighter and Apollo #6 is an issue of the series Midnighter and Apollo (Volume 1) with a cover date of May, 2017. It was published on March 1, 2017.

Notes
- Final issue.
- Apollo and Midnighter's past history is eventually restored as a consequence of the unknotting of the timeline and the rebirth of the Multiverse.
- Apollo and Midnighter's adventures chronologically continue in the reborn Multiverse in Superman and the Authority (Volume 1).
Trivia
- The name of the Castle Epicaricacius comes from Greek epikhairekakía, meaning "joy upon evil".
